Where applicable, authors must obtain necessary ethical approvals, permits, and permissions before conducting research.
Authors must disclose any financial, institutional, professional, or personal relationships that could influence the interpretation or presentation of the research.
If authors discover a significant error or inaccuracy in their published work, they are obligated to promptly notify the journal and cooperate in issuing corrections, clarifications, or retractions where necessary.
